The "10-Foot Attitude"

Sam Walton had a way with people. He had a charm and a charisma that made people feel welcome and important.

Sam's people skills can still be felt today through Wal-Mart's associates. When Sam visited his stores, he asked the associates to make a pledge: "I want you to promise that whenever you come within 10 feet of a customer, you will look him in the eye, greet him and ask if you can help him."

This pledge is what we now call our "10-foot attitude." Sam learned the power of this attitude in college while campaigning for class president. "I learned that one of the secrets to leadership was the simplest thing of all: Speak to people coming down the sidewalk before they speak to you.... I would always look ahead and speak to the person coming toward me."

Sam not only won that election, but he also became a leader in other campus organizations and carried his leadership and friendly smile wherever he went.

Low Prices, Every Day

"No matter what we pay for it, if we get a great deal, pass it along to the customer."

One of Wal-Mart's first store managers recalled Sam Walton saying these words when the manager suggested raising prices. "Sam wouldn't let us hedge on a price at all," the store manager remembers.

Our pricing philosophy at Walmart.com is the same as it is in Wal-Mart stores. When we get a price break from a supplier, we pass it along to our customers, often in the form of a "Rollback."
